Touchwood have been producing high quality, accurate reproduction longcase clocks for more than 35 years.  Because of this wealth of experience and expertise, we are able to offer a unique, second to none service.  Crossbanding, stringing, marquetry work and inlay are all readily incorporated into the chosen design.  Movements and dials can be selected from those of high quality German manufacture, through to accurate hand built copies of English movements with hand engraved brass or painted dials.
Due to the very large number of combinations of timbers and styles that are possible, the designs shown in these pages represent just a selection of those possibilities.

Country Style

These are the flat topped designs known as Country Style, which can be elaborately veneered.

Pagoda Top Style

These are the ornate styles with decorative brasswork on the hood and case.

Swan Pediment Style

The Swan Pediment is named after the shape of a swan's neck.

Caddy Top Style

 This is another elaborate design which dates back to the early 17th century, and is often seen with a figured veneered case.
